D6828: uncommit: add options to update to the current user or current date

mharbison72 (Matt Harbison) phabricator at mercurial-scm.org
Mon Sep 9 12:49:56 EDT 2019


mharbison72 added a comment.


  In D6828#100139 <https://phab.mercurial-scm.org/D6828#100139>, @pulkit wrote:
  
  > I guess `--interactive` is the only flag left which is extra in evolve version, right?
  
  No:
  
    -a --all                 uncommit all changes when no arguments given
    -i --interactive         interactive mode to uncommit (EXPERIMENTAL)
    -r --rev REV             revert commit content to REV instead
       --revert              discard working directory changes after uncommit
    -n --note TEXT           store a note on uncommit
  
  I'd like to port `--interactive` and lean towards `--all` too for consistency with `revert` and `resolve`, though I can see how it might be used as an alternative to `rollback` in its current form.  I didn't take the time to understand what `--rev` is doing.

REPOSITORY
  rHG Mercurial

CHANGES SINCE LAST ACTION
  https://phab.mercurial-scm.org/D6828/new/

REVISION DETAIL
  https://phab.mercurial-scm.org/D6828

To: mharbison72, #hg-reviewers, pulkit
Cc: pulkit, mercurial-devel


More information about the Mercurial-devel mailing list